    What It's Like to Work Here

    You will operate in a relentless ship-fast rhythm where slide decks are banned in favor of live demos. You are expected to sweat every word of product copy and maintain an obsession with craft, guided by a first principles approach. While asynchronous communication and remote flexibility afford significant autonomy, the expectations are sky-high, often blurring the boundaries of work-life balance. You will also navigate a rapidly shifting landscape where AI tools like v0 are turning everyone into mini CEOs, meaning traditional individual contributor work is being heavily automated. If you survive the notoriously grueling interview process, you will find a highly transparent management team, though the rapidly scaling environment can occasionally feel cliquey with muddy boundaries around ownership.

    What People Say About Vercel's Culture

    Synthesized from public sources · open to employees who claim their company

    SummarySynthesized

    Employee sentiment at Vercel paints a picture of a thrilling but exhausting environment. The engineering-driven culture demands excellence and speed with rapid weekly iteration cycles acting as the heartbeat of the company. While the transition to highly autonomous async-first workflows is praised, the relentless pace and sky-high standards take a toll with many citing a serious risk of burnout. Recent aggressive moves toward AI automation have created a complex internal dynamic. The shift toward turning employees into mini CEOs who manage AI agents rather than doing traditional IC work has generated anxiety alongside the productivity gains, notably after a ten-person sales team was automated away. Furthermore, as the company rapidly scales under its massive new valuation, growing pains are evident. Transparency remains high, but shifting ownership boundaries and emerging cliques are making internal navigation trickier.
